Description
Summary:This paper presents the method of increasing the input power factor and output voltage fundamental harmonic of the cycloconverter based on bridge circuit and proposed to be used in power generation system of aircraft. The increase of the output voltage fundamental harmonic is achieved by introducing the combined control law. The combined control signal assumes the artificial introduction of components that are multiple of third harmonic by summation the sine wave signal with the triangle wave signal that have three-tuple frequency of fundamental harmonic. The main energy characteristics of the cycloconverter were obtained.
